LONDON MACHINE WORKS: EXPERT PLC PROGRAMMING WITH SIEMENS PLCS
At London Machine Works, we offer specialized PLC programming services for both new installations and existing systems that require updates or modifications. Using industry-leading Siemens PLCs, we help clients streamline their manufacturing operations, automate processes, and ensure reliable control for various industrial applications. Whether you’re launching a new production line or upgrading an existing setup, our team of skilled engineers can provide the tailored programming support you need to optimize performance, enhance reliability, and increase operational efficiency.
Why Siemens PLCs?
Siemens is a global leader in automation technology, renowned for its high-quality, versatile PLCs. Siemens PLCs are robust, scalable, and designed to meet the demands of diverse industries, from manufacturing and logistics to energy and process control. These controllers offer powerful features like real-time data monitoring, advanced diagnostics, and easy integration with other industrial systems, making them an ideal choice for automation in both large-scale and small-scale operations.
Key benefits of Siemens PLCs include:
-
High Reliability and Durability
Siemens PLCs are built to withstand industrial environments, ensuring stable, reliable control under demanding conditions. -
Scalability
Whether you need a simple controller or a complex automation solution, Siemens PLCs can scale to fit your requirements. -
Advanced Connectivity
Siemens PLCs easily integrate with SCADA systems, HMIs, and other automation components, offering seamless communication for centralized control. -
Comprehensive Diagnostics and Monitoring
With built-in diagnostic tools and real-time monitoring, Siemens PLCs make it easy to maintain and troubleshoot systems, minimizing downtime.
Our Siemens PLC Programming Services
At London Machine Works, we offer complete PLC programming services tailored to meet the unique needs of each client. From initial setup to system upgrades, our team has extensive experience designing and programming Siemens PLCs for a wide range of applications. Our services include:
1. New PLC System Programming
If you’re installing a new Siemens PLC system, we provide end-to-end programming and configuration services. Our team will work closely with you to understand your production requirements, automation goals, and any specific constraints. We then develop a customized program that optimizes your system’s performance and reliability.
-
System Design and Specification
We begin with a thorough assessment of your requirements, helping you select the ideal Siemens PLC model and configuring it to match your automation objectives. -
Programming and Testing
Our engineers develop a detailed, customized program, ensuring seamless control over each part of your process. Before installation, we conduct extensive testing to confirm the program’s functionality and reliability. -
Installation and Commissioning
Once the program is finalized, we install and commission the PLC system, ensuring everything operates as expected. We also provide training and support to ensure a smooth transition to your new system.
2. Upgrades and Modifications for Existing Systems
For companies with existing Siemens PLC installations, we offer programming updates, modifications, and upgrades to improve efficiency, introduce new capabilities, or adapt to changes in production needs. Our team can update your PLC software, add new functionality, and make necessary adjustments to optimize performance.
-
Legacy System Upgrades
If you’re operating on outdated PLC software or hardware, we can help you migrate to the latest Siemens platforms, enhancing performance and reducing the risk of system failures. -
Programming Modifications
When your production requirements evolve, so too must your control system. We provide programming modifications to help your PLC adapt to new workflows, product specifications, or production targets. -
Data Integration and Connectivity Enhancements
For facilities needing improved data collection or enhanced connectivity with SCADA, HMI, or other systems, we can expand your PLC’s functionality to support real-time monitoring and data exchange.
3. Troubleshooting and Maintenance Support
In addition to programming and upgrades, we provide PLC troubleshooting and maintenance services. Our engineers are experienced in diagnosing and resolving a variety of PLC issues, ensuring minimal downtime and efficient operation.
-
Fault Diagnosis and Troubleshooting
Using Siemens diagnostic tools, we identify the root cause of any issues and quickly implement solutions to restore normal operations. -
Routine Maintenance and Support
Regular maintenance is key to prolonging the life of your PLC system. We offer ongoing support to keep your Siemens PLCs running smoothly and to prevent potential issues before they impact production.

